1 Colorado State University (CSU) Atlantic Hurricane Season Forecast Dr. Philip Klotzbach of Colorado State University (CSU) has issued his latest forecast for the Atlantic Hurricane Season. The forecast calls for 14 named storms, 6 hurricanes and 2 major (Category 3+) hurricanes between the months of June and November. This is a slight reduction from the April forecast, and also includes May s Subtropical Storm Alberto. With the release of the forecast, Dr. Klotzbach is predicting near normal tropical cyclone activity in the Atlantic Basin during the upcoming season. The report cites several factors as to why slightly increased activity is being forecast. One such main factor regards the eventual phase of ENSO (El Niño- Southern Oscillation) during the rest of the hurricane season. Sea surface temperatures have warmed during April and May in the central and eastern tropical Pacific Ocean and ENSO-neutral conditions currently exist. Considerable changes in ENSO often occur during June and July, and statistical and dynamical forecast models are predicting warm-neutral or weak El Niño conditions during the peak seasonal months of August, September, and October. CSU s best guess estimate at this time is that warm ENSO-neutral conditions will be present by the peak of the Atlantic hurricane season. A second factor revolves around current sea surface temperatures across the North Atlantic Ocean. At present, the current anomaly pattern is not conducive for an active hurricane season. The pattern currently features cold anomalies in the far North Atlantic, cold in the subtropical eastern Atlantic and extending into the tropical Atlantic, and warm anomalies off the east coast of the United States. The last two months have featured anomalous warming off the U.S. East Coast and cooling along the west coast of Africa. The likely driver of this pattern is an abnormally strong ridge of high pressure draped across the eastern and central Atlantic Ocean. This has helped cause strong trade winds that prompt upwelling, mixing, and enhanced evaporation in the tropical Atlantic. Colorado State notes that if current conditions in the tropical Atlantic persist, or if El Niño develops more quickly than expected, a further reduction in their forecast may be required. However, if the tropical Atlantic begins to warm and the tropical Pacific was to remain neutral, their forecast may need to be increased. Large uncertainties for the season remain. 4 Tropical Storm Risk (TSR) Atlantic Hurricane Season Forecast Tropical Storm Risk (TSR), which is part of Aon Benfield Research s academic and industry collaboration, has issued its April forecast for the Atlantic Hurricane Season. TSR s Professor Mark Saunders and Dr. Adam Lea are forecasting 9 named storms, 4 hurricanes and 1 major (Category 3+) hurricanes between the months of June and November. This is a significant reduction from TSR s initial projections of tropical activity released in December 2017 and April. TSR says there is a 69 percent likelihood that the projected activity would be in the bottom one-third of Atlantic Hurricane Seasons dating to The report specifies two primary factors as to why a below normal hurricane season is now being forecast. The main reason is that TSR cites the considerable cooling of sea surface temperatures in the tropical North Atlantic Ocean and Caribbean Sea during April and May. This temperature shift is associated with the strengthening of the Azores ridge of high pressure. Additionally, TSR notes that such conditions are likely to enhance stronger-than-normal trade winds in the Atlantic s Main Development Region (MDR) during the peak months of August and September. The agency further explains the expectation of ENSO-neutral or weak El Niño conditions from July to September. This is based on the latest dynamical and statistical model output. However, TSR stresses that there remain sizeable uncertainties in the anticipated phase of ENSO, actual sea surface temperatures, and the strength of vertical wind shear. Each parameter has a direct influence on the number of named storms. Drs. Saunders and Lea currently project that there is just a 7% probability that the Atlantic Hurricane Season ACE Index will be above-average, a 24% likelihood it will be near-normal, and a 69% chance it will be below-normal. The Accumulated Cyclone Energy Index is equal to the sum of the squares of 6-hourly maximum sustained wind speeds (in knots) for all systems while they are at least tropical storm strength. The ACE Landfall Index is the sum of the squares of hourly maximum sustained wind speeds (in knots) for all systems while they are at least tropical storm strength and over the United States mainland (reduced by a factor of 6).
